Colt Johnson shares his plans amid divorce from Vanessa Guerra

Colt Johnson, the star of 90 Day Fiancé, has gone quiet on estranged wife Vanessa Guerra, and he does not hide how he feels about it.

In a talk with Us Weekly at Us’ 90 Days: Hunt For Love party on Monday, May 19, the 39-year-old television personality and reality show star revealed, “We’re divorced or working on it, but yeah, we’re not really talking.”

He went on to make it clear by saying, “We’re not communicating. It makes me sad, but things happen, I guess.”

For the unversed, Johnson and the 35-year-old reality television star met each other for the first time on 90 Day: Happily Ever After? season 5 in June 2020.

However, he was in a relationship with Jess Caroline and clarified that Guerra was just a “best friend” at that time.

Notably, when the show’s tell-all episode aired, Johnson confessed to his romance with Guerra despite being in a relationship with Caroline.

In the summer of 2025, he wants to try his luck again at love on 90 Days: Hunt for Love.

“I’m recently divorced, so I really just wanted to try something new and just put myself out there. I’m feeling pretty good. Got some new glasses. I feel pretty good,” Johnson noted.
